Zero Knowledge Proofs And Their Role In Blockchain Privacy

What connects zero knowledge proofs and their role in blockchain privacy to ancient empires, modern technology, and everything in between? More than you'd expect.

At a Glance

The Ancient Roots Of Zero Knowledge Proofs

The origins of zero knowledge proofs can be traced back to the dawn of human civilization. In fact, some of the earliest known examples of zero knowledge techniques date back to ancient Egypt and Mesopotamia, where priests and scribes used ingenious methods to verify the authenticity of important documents without revealing their sensitive contents.

One such technique, known as the "Egyptian Papyrus Trick," involved folding a papyrus scroll in a specific way before handing it to an inspector. The inspector could then unfold the scroll and verify that it contained the expected text, without ever actually reading the contents. This allowed the original owner to prove the document's authenticity while preserving its secrecy.

The Mesopotamian "Clay Tablet Challenge"

In ancient Mesopotamia, scribes would sometimes engage in a "clay tablet challenge" to demonstrate their skills. One scribe would create a clay tablet with a complex cuneiform inscription, then hand it to a rival scribe. The challenged scribe could then verify that the tablet contained the expected inscription, without actually reading the text - a primitive form of zero knowledge proof.

The Cryptographic Revolution

While these ancient techniques were ingenious, it wasn't until the 1980s that the modern concept of zero knowledge proofs was formally defined and developed. The breakthrough came in 1985, when MIT researchers Shafi Goldwasser, Silvio Micali, and Charles Rackoff published a groundbreaking paper titled "The Knowledge Complexity of Interactive Proof Systems."

In this paper, the researchers introduced the idea of a interactive proof system - a way for one party to prove a statement to another party, without revealing any additional information. This laid the foundations for zero knowledge proofs as we know them today.

"Zero knowledge proofs allow you to prove that you know something, without revealing what that something is. It's like being able to prove you have a secret, without telling anybody what the secret is." - Cryptographer Adi Shamir

The Blockchain Connection

The rise of blockchain technology in the 2010s has brought zero knowledge proofs to the forefront of cryptographic research and implementation. Blockchains, with their inherent focus on decentralization and transparency, have a natural affinity for zero knowledge techniques.

One of the earliest and most prominent applications of zero knowledge proofs in blockchain was the development of Zcash, a privacy-focused cryptocurrency that uses a zero knowledge proof system called zk-SNARKs to conceal transaction details. This allows Zcash users to make transactions without revealing the sender, recipient, or amount involved.

The Breakthrough of zk-SNARKs

zk-SNARKs, or "zero-knowledge Succinct Non-interactive ARguments of Knowledge," are a specific type of zero knowledge proof that are particularly well-suited for blockchain applications. zk-SNARKs are incredibly efficient, allowing for quick verification of complex statements without revealing the underlying information.

Dive deeper into this topic

The Future Of Zero Knowledge Proofs

As blockchain technology continues to evolve, the role of zero knowledge proofs is only expected to grow. Researchers are constantly developing new and more powerful zero knowledge proof systems, with applications far beyond just cryptocurrency.

Some exciting areas of research include using zero knowledge proofs for decentralized identity management, privacy-preserving machine learning, and even zero knowledge voting systems. The potential for zero knowledge proofs to enhance privacy and security in the digital world is immense.

Curious? Learn more here

Unlocking the Future of Privacy

As we've seen, zero knowledge proofs have a rich history spanning millennia, from ancient scribes to modern cryptographers. And with the rise of blockchain technology, these powerful privacy-preserving techniques are poised to play an ever-greater role in shaping the future of our digital world.

By allowing individuals and organizations to verify information without revealing sensitive details, zero knowledge proofs have the potential to unlock a new era of privacy, security, and trust - one where we can harness the power of data and technology without sacrificing our fundamental rights. The implications are far-reaching, and the future of zero knowledge proofs is an exciting frontier that we've only begun to explore.

Found this article useful? Share it!

Comments

0/255